Dear friends,

I know that changing Sold-To Party after a Sales Order/Contract is created is NOT possible in SAP. But are there any user exits that can be used for changing the sold-to party after the contract is created.

If the above is not possible, is it possible to run the standard SD reports on a partner (who would be the new sold-to party) instead of running it on the actual Sold-To Party.

Kindly confirm.

Hi Ramesh,

You can change the Sold-to Party in Contract or Sales Order, its SAP Standard. You dont need any Uxer Exit to do this. Goto Sales Overview screen, you can see the Sold-to Party field is open and editable. Change the Sold-To Party from here, if you see the same at header --> Partner Tab it is greyed out and not changable.

It does not matter, you change it from overview screen and you can see the changes are imposed at all levels.

But once you have created any delivery or Billing document, then you will not be able to change Sold-To Party. Hope this will resolve your problem, if u r still not able to do it then u can always contact me.

Ramesh,

Yes we can change the Sold to party after creation but before that you should see that no subsequent documents are created for this order. In that case it is greyed out and you will not be allowed to change the sold to party.

In case you have changed the sold to party that you have created. The subsequent documents are created bearing the new sold to party then in the reports you will find new sold to party being reflected.

You can change the Sold To Party as long as there is no subsequent document to that sale order. But if you generate any subsequent document, then this field would become grey and you cannot change this.
